Cuscal appoints Bronwyn Yam as Chief Product Officer

Bronwyn’s appointment as Chief Product Officer signals this ongoing commitment to delivering exceptional products and services to clients and customers.
Reporting into Chief Executive Officer, Craig Kennedy, Bronwyn will manage the development of Cuscal’s payments and regulated data products and services. The role is key in driving the Domains’ delivery of high value, profitable products from strategy, development, management, and maintenance throughout their entire lifecycle from conception to launch to end of life.
Bronwyn Yam is an innovative product expert with over 25 years of experience driving transformational change across organisations and their associated teams. She has extensive experience in the Financial Services industry, having held strategy, product and P&L responsibilities across lending, payments, and banking portfolios.
Bronwyn’s prior role was Chief Product Officer of Tyro Payments where she was responsible for the entire product portfolio of the payments company. Forming the foundation of her knowledge over a twelve-year tenure with Commonwealth Bank of Australia, she departed the bank as the Managing Director of Commerce and Platforms where she was accountable for the overall profitability of the payments business across all distribution channels.
Before moving to Australia in 2004, Bronwyn had a consulting career with Arthur Andersen Business Consulting in the United States of America and across Asia working with clients from multiple industries from manufacturing to financial services. She is passionate about challenging the status quo and delivering on innovative processes and solutions.
Bronwyn holds a Master of Business Administration from the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ology and a Bachelor of Arts from the University of California, Los Angeles.
As Australia’s leading independent provider of end-to-end payment solutions, Cuscal is the largest Australian payment processor after the Big 4 banks.
